When selecting the best gaming monitor, keep these features in mind:
Refresh Rate: Smooth Gameplay in Every Frame
Refresh rate determines how many frames per second your monitor can display. A higher refresh rate translates to smoother motion and less blur, especially in fast-paced genres like FPS. While 60 Hertz (Hz) is the entry-level standard, moving up to 144Hz or 165Hz provides a significant leap in fluidity. Competitive gamers may even opt for 240Hz monitors for lightning-fast responsiveness.
Resolution: Clearer, Sharper Visuals
Resolution affects how crisp and detailed your visuals look. While 1080p (Full High Definition) remains a popular choice for budget-conscious gamers, 1440p (Quad High Definition) strikes an excellent balance between quality and affordability.
Looking for the pinnacle of clarity and realism? 4K (Ultra High Definition) is unmatched, but it requires a powerful gaming rig to handle the demands of higher resolutions.
Screen Size and Type: The Perfect Fit
A monitor's size and design is important in your overall gaming experience. Monitors between 24 to 32 inches are the sweet spot for most setups, with larger displays offering a more cinematic feel.
Flat Monitors: They’re ideal for those who prefer affordability and versatility. These monitors are great for casual gamers and for those who have multi-purpose PC setups.
Curved Monitors: Designed to wrap around your field of vision, curved screens provide a more immersive experience, especially for racing and simulation games like Need for Speed and The Sims. These monitors also reduce glare and visual distortion.
Panel Technology: In-Plane Switching (IPS) vs. Twisted Nematic (TN) vs. Vertical Alignment (VA)
Monitor panels impact your gaming experience, too. Take note of the differences of these panels:
IPS Panels: Offer vibrant colors and wide viewing angles, making them ideal for games with rich graphics and vivid details
TN Panels: Prioritize speed over visuals, with the fastest response times for competitive gamers
VA Panels: Deliver excellent contrast and deep blacks—perfect for cinematic or story-driven games

1. Check Ventilation and Cooling Systems
Overheating—both for you and your equipment—will ruin gaming sessions. Install cooling fans or portable AC units to keep your space ventilated.
For your gaming gear, consider cooling pads for laptops or external GPU cooling systems. Staying cool improves focus and helps maintain consistent device performance during high-pressure gameplay.
2. Test the Lighting
Proper lighting goes beyond aesthetics; it plays a vital role in reducing eye strain during extended gaming sessions. Opt for soft, ambient lighting that minimizes glare on screens. RGB lighting, desk lamps with dimmable features, and bias lighting behind monitors help reduce eye fatigue and create an immersive gaming atmosphere.
3. Remember the Basics
Always take breaks like the 20-20-20 technique. This means every 20 minutes, you should look at something 20 feet away for at least 20 seconds. Use in-game pauses to stand, stretch, or walk around. This practice helps prevent eye strain and body stiffness, and also improves blood circulation. No one wants to sprain a wrist during a boss battle, right?
Your monitor should also align with your eye level to avoid tilting your head forward. And before you start playing, you should keep water and healthy snacks nearby to maintain your energy without interruptions.
